Here's how Saqib Saleem replied to netizens who asked him to go Pakistan!

Bollywood actor and Huma Qureshi's brother Saqib Saleem, who gained popularity for films like 'Mere Dad Ki Maruti', 'Dishoom' and 'Race 3', took to social media to shut the people, who were asking him to go to Pakistan. Saqib, on his Twitter handle, gave a befitting reply to the haters and wrote, 'I am a proud Indian who loves his country. But if I feel like somethings amiss I will ask questions. If you got a problem with that then I am afraid it’s your problem to take care of. Some of you are hell bent on sending me to Pakistan. Please don't worry abt me I am fine where i am'. One of the Twitter users replied to his tweet and asked the actor that what should we ask Kashmiri people and what exactly is wrong. Taking a dig at the tweet, Saqib replied that no one can get in touch with their families, the elected representatives are under house arrest and the communication has been blocked, but other than that, all is okay. Meanwhile, on the work front, Saqib will next be seen in '83' alongside Ranveer Singh.
